081 – Fight Of The Tigers #7

Ggang, ggang, ggagak-!

Sounds of the blades hitting each other resonated violently in the surroundings.

Whenever the big halberd and the slender sword collided, it would create sparks, which brightened up people’s faces.

━I’ve never seen such a high-level fight, I can’t even see their hands move!

━A necromancer seems to be strong even without their undead. Do you see those burning talismans?

━As expected of those that defeated Professor Balan…

Mirna and Elga clashed fiercely against each other.

Elga pressed her gigantic halberd on Mirna.

“Do you really think you can stop my Crusher with that thin sword just by putting on some talismans? I’ll make that high nose of yours flat!”

“Keueuk.”

Mirna could barely block the attack with her thin sword. Her knees were bent, seemingly about to get crushed to the ground.

Then, Mirna swung the fan she was holding in her other hand. Probably because she couldn’t stand Elga’s offensive.

Hwiik jak-.

Something similar to a purple talisman, hidden behind the fan, was stuck on Elga. At the same time, it exploded, spreading white smoke.

“Tsk. Too shallow.”

The surprise attack was a success, yet Mirna’s expression wasn’t bright. After all, it didn’t have enough firepower to take down Elga.

“Your petty tricks are only annoying me.”

Elga just waved off the smoke with her arm. Meanwhile, everyone was looking forward to what would happen in this tense confrontation.

“This reminds me of the old days…!”

Professor Stella was also looking at the two Young Ladies with interest.

“We used to fight like this before. At first glance, it might look like a necromancer without their undead would be at a disadvantage. However, the Draco Family are also fluent in rituals and talismans.”

“I see.”

I moderately nodded.

Actually, I didn’t pay much attention to the battle between Elga and Mirna.

Rather, I was really curious about Professor Stella’s past. There was also the fact that she used to be friends with the fathers of these two girls, back when they were still undergraduate students.

So, did she know about Isaiah?

To my question, Stella only ambiguously answered, “Who knows.”

My ability might not be like Aira’s, but I still had ways to detect lies.

And, I did not miss the fact that Professor Stella’s pointy ears perked up when she heard the name Isaiah!

Kang, kagang, kang-!

The sound of metal grazing against each other was ringing in my ears.

I then said to Stella.

“Professor Stella. I’m not asking as your student, but as the Inspector of Angmar Kingdom. As a member of the four great families of Angmar, it would be better if you tell the truth.”

Seureuk-.

Only then did the 132-year-old fairy’s gaze turn away from the duel. Her amber eyes had a patronizing glint as they looked towards me, as if saying, “Oh, look at this guy-.”

“Inspector of Angmar Kingdom?”

“That’s right. I have been entrusted with great responsibilities by the current Queen Aira. It would be good for you to help me out and honestly relay some information.”

I didn’t like to flash my authority.

My theory was that, if one had to use authority just to solve some problems at work, there would undoubtedly be backlash one day.

… But, sometimes, it was better to use it.

Just like right now.

“So it’s Queen Aira’s order….”

Professor Stella was exiled from her own family, the Bellhawk.

Thus, it would be beneficial for her to help me, especially if she wanted to return to her family one day. At the moment, as a professor in Ark, she would not be able to ignore that.

“…….”

In fact, Stella was clearly in silent agony. I wasn’t insensitive enough to miss her internal worries and hesitation.

In the end, Professor Stella let out a helpless sigh.

“… I don’t know why that name was brought up again. But, whatever it is, things might be different from what the Inspector is thinking.”

“I’ll be the judge of that.”

In response to my firm answer, Stella spoke in a voice only I could hear.

“Adventure party.”

“Yes?”

“That’s all I can tell you. Now, if you’ll excuse me, I have to get moving.”

Kwang-!

An intense explosion suddenly warmed the air.

When I turned my head, I could see Elga holding her halberd to the sky, wielding some sort of electricity.

Facing her was Mirna, who had scattered dozens of talismans on the ground.

━Run, run away-!

━This is no longer a spar! You will get hurt if you get caught up in it!

The crowd was running away with their ąsses in order not to get entangled in the fight.

“That’s enough, you two, this is not a life and death battle!”

It was a situation where I didn’t know what would have happened had Professor Stella not intervened and stopped the fight.

“Now, both of you, cease! Otherwise, I’ll penalize you.”

Eventually, the duel was stopped.

Elga and Mirna, who were severely wounded, separated from each other and went to their respective corners.

“Hey, commoner, come and help me.”

Mirna, who was bleeding with cuts all over her face, called me.

However, my eyes were on Elga. Her school uniform was torn and there appeared to be burns on her arms and legs. At the same time, Elga was also looking at me with her blue eyes.

“What are you doing? Come over here and help me put some band-aid on my face.”

My heart went to Elga, but I was currently known as Mirna’s suitor.

If I went to her, people would definitely gossip. And, Mirna would also get very angry before trying to pull my head off my shoulders…

─I can’t forgive you for playing with a woman’s heart!

─Hieek…!

… That was probably what would happen.

Elga and I already had some talk, so should I go to Mirna for now?

However, when I took a step towards Mirna.

━Hey, look at Lady Lioness-.

The buzzing crowd buzzed even more.

Turning my head, I saw Elga’s flushed face with tears running down her cheeks.

Rather than tears of sadness, it seemed more like anger because she couldn’t control her emotions…

Badeulbadeul-.

There was no mistaking it, Elga was crying!

Swish.

Finally, Elga left her seat altogether, with people in an uproar because of her departure.

━She must have felt bad for not being able to finish the fight. I can’t believe she cried….

━I’ve heard that the Lioness’ risk their lives in battle. I really have nothing but respect for them.

━Truly a role model of nobility living in honor and glory!

These were what people said. However, I could see that Elga wasn’t crying because the duel was stopped.

She was crying because of me!

I made a woman cry! I was more afraid of Elga’s tears than her clenched fists.

And then, everything went dark.
